About the job

Shape the future of automotive finance with Nissan Financial Services as a Senior Dealer Credit Analyst. This job offers a unique opportunity to influence commercial lending decisions while managing a substantial dealer portfolio. Join a supportive team that values strong business relationships and fosters career growth.

You'll be responsible for

📋

Managing a dealer portfolio

Overseeing a significant commercial dealer portfolio and influencing lending decisions.
📝

Assessing credit applications

Evaluating and recommending complex dealer and fleet credit applications.
📊

Analyzing financial statements

Preparing high-quality credit submissions based on financial analysis.
